Raymond is a boyish thirty-something content with his wife Nancy and son Kai Zhen who studies K2. Nancy decides to spur up Kai Zhen's "talents" with an onslaught of extracurricular activities. They are tickets to a handful of certificates and awards so that Kai Zhen will not be overshadowed by other kids and may receive placement in more elite schools. Disapproving of the move, Raymond hopes his son could enjoy his childhood. Nancy insists and asks Raymond to find Kai Zhen a referee for school enrolment. In the meanwhile, Raymond was sacked and had to leave his job of twenty years. A painful journey begins with his job hunt and eventual sale of his own favourite toys and pleasures. For the sake of his son, he swallows his pride and begs his old boss to be his son’s referee.

In order to fulfill the expectation of her mom and her grandpa, Nam is raised as a boy since she was born. She dresses like a boy every day before going to school, gets changed back to a girl’s uniform, and puts on a boy’s outfit before heading home. Her hysterical mom anticipates the return of her husband, which is a dream never come true. Nam finds her only shelter at her childhood friend Yeung’s house, a place where she can finally be herself, i.e. doing laundry for her underwear. But her life changes on the day when Yeung disappears.

Death is a moment whose reverberation endures for the living. Three students from the Audio-Visual team are shooting a documentary on a schoolmate who has recently committed suicide. It is intended to convey a ‘positive message’ to the entire school about the importance of life. During interviews, the students notice some discrepancies in the testimonies, particularly those by a prefect and a teacher, while friends of the deceased seem to be withholding some inconvenient truth. Should the team pursue the truth, or act as the school’s propagandist? Filmed in a mocumentary style, The Handbook of Suicide Prevention challenges and exposes the hypocrisy and suppression that haunt adolescence.

Anger breeds anger, and hatred breeds hatred. Restaurant owner Mr. Wong stresses about the business when he has to face rent increases every year. Restless and tense, he channels his anger to Ka Yeung, the timid newest employee. Taunted by his customers, his boss and life in general, Ka Yeung is barely keeping his head above the water with his father being an unlicensed hawker. One incident escalates to another like a Greek tragedy and anger spirals out of control, causing irreparable outcome. This is a story about two men who live in an unforgiving city, both trying to find their way out but ended up hurting each other.

Japanese band Aomori Hensou is the only thing that makes Mei Bo feels alive in this mundane city until she meets Lily, her new neighbour. It happens that Lily is also a huge fan of the band so they start to get along with each other like twin sisters. They wander around the city, from second-hand CD shops, to goldfish market, and other secret spots that nobody knows. Lily eventually gets tired of the excitement from Mei Bo and starts exploring the city on her own. One day Lily appears at the door of Mei Bo’s home together with the news of the break up announcement of their favourite band, but there is only an empty room left in front of her.
